Program areas at Open Doors International USA
Social economic support: in 2024, over $2.6 million was donated towards Open Doors International social economic support program. These are programs aimed at providing socio-economic development, livelihood or practical aid to christians and equipping churches to meet the socio-economic needs of the broader communities around them.
Bibles & literature distribution: in 2024, we provided $636,395 to Open Doors International's programs seeking to provide persecuted christians with access to bibles and other christian discipleship and literature resources.
Training: in 2024, we provided over $1.3 million to Open Doors International's training programs. These are programs equipping persecuted christians to stand strong and to share the love of christ in the midst of their persecution and to equip the church to train disciples in these difficult contexts.
Public awareness & motivation: programs designed to help north american christians become aware of the issues of global christian persecution and to mobilize them in prayer for the persecuted church.
Advocacy & research: programs designed to create credible research detailing the realities and breadth of christian persecution. In addition to informing the church, this research is also used by acedemics, politicians and media needing authoritative yet credible research on christian persecution. These programs are also designed to help politicians and policy makers be aware and informed on issues of christian persecution.

Financials for Open Doors International USA
Revenues | FYE 12/2024 | FYE 12/2023 | % Change |
---|
Total grants, contributions, etc. | $9,089,008 | $7,943,504 | 14.4% |
Program services | $0 | $0 | - |
Investment income and dividends | $17,122 | $4 | - |
Tax-exempt bond proceeds | $0 | $0 | - |
Royalty revenue | $0 | $0 | - |
Net rental income | $0 | $0 | - |
Net gain from sale of non-inventory assets | $0 | $0 | - |
Net income from fundraising events | $0 | $0 | - |
Net income from gaming activities | $0 | $0 | - |
Net income from sales of inventory | $0 | $0 | - |
Miscellaneous revenues | $4,196 | $154 | 2624.7% |
Total revenues | $9,110,326 | $7,943,662 | 14.7% |
